Overview  

Cellular Tracking Technologies (CTT) is a global leader in wildlife telemetry and IoT solutions with headquarters in Cape May, NJ. CTT was founded in 2007 by a team of scientists and engineers who wanted to vastly improve the state of wildlife telemetry.

CTT brings the newest innovations and highest levels of service to the wildlife research market and has now operated in over 50 countries. We are a nimble company that constantly strives to improve our products to support conservation research around the globe.
